一个黑头发的技术人员说点产品运作以及流程问题

首先声明,我不是产品经理,也不是项目经理,对做产品、项目,我也不怎么懂,我只是个程序员,现在我只是以“一个程序员”自己的领悟,对一个产品如何运作,说点流程问题:
1)产品前期,调研市场需求,确定此产品到底是不是适合做?产品的用户群?产品的定位?产品所属的行业?行业的背景?…..这些问题,我们必须要有个肯定的答案
 
2)确定做了。接下是不是就准备做的呢,我的理解肯定是“no”。因为需要拟一些“必须的”的文档,这些是总结,是可行性的总结,是需求的总结,是概要设计的总结,是详细设计的总结,这些文档绝不是形式,在团队内部是很有分量的,是前期工作的结晶,是为后期做准备的
 
3)此时,团队人员的心态如何,是否都认可,是否都有一致的目标,是否都了解了产品的需求,是否对将要开发的产品充满了信心,这些问题,我觉得是必须要知道的。项目经理,不就是管理、调度团队的资源的核心人物吗,但是如何能很好的调度呢,这些不需要知道吗??
 
4)其实,还有很多问题,还有很多未知的问题,但是,是否还需要慢慢地去调查,慢慢地去探索,这就是看,我们自己规划的产品周期了。产品的一个目标,是尽快地抢占市场,这是急迫的
 
5)此时,产品可能已经在开发之中了,开发中的“程序员”是有火花的。此时,不要压制他们,让他们提出心中的疑问、思想,因为这些很有价值。至于采不采取,当然需要商量,需要项目经理、产品经理自己去审度
6)在规定的周期内,产品是否已经开发完毕。此时,谁都知道,需要严格的测试:单元测试、功能测试、压力测试等等。 没有经过严格测试过的产品,你就能拿出给客户用,你敢拿出去给客户用?对,抢占市场很迫切,但是测试永远很重要
 
7)销售人员在销售产品的时候,也会有想法,回来后,当然需要提出这些想法,但是此时产品经理,项目经理,又该如何去抉择?这也是个很重要的问题。新的需求,经过商讨,需要加,那就依然决然的加。但是加的时候,是否考虑到项目修改大不大,修改方不方便,当然易修改、易维护等等这些性质,在产品搭架构的时候,就应该去考虑
 
8)修改后的产品,是否需要测试,该怎么测试?全部进行测试一遍,我觉得这也不可能。那到底该如何测试,该有怎么样的一个测试方案呢,这些问题,当然应该交给“专业人士”——测试经理去考虑。在这里,我也说说,我自己的想法。我觉得一个合格的测试经理,必须了解,他将要测试的这个产品的需求,此时,那些“形式”的文档就起作用了。充分了解需求之后,是否可以将产品分为模块进行测试或者其他的方案。因为需求的变动频率是很高的,所以,我必须思考该如何应对?


猜你喜欢

转载自blog.csdn.net/nieyinyin/article/details/45172433